Galaxy Enterprises Inc. Signs Letter of Intent to Acquire Impact Media LLC

OREM, Utah--(BUSINESS WIRE)--March 4, 1999--Galaxy Enterprises Inc. (OTC BB:GLXY - news), an established e-commerce provider, operator of the popular 1,700-storefront Galaxy Mall and MatchSite search engine, Thursday announced that it has signed a letter of intent to acquire the business of Impact Media LLC, also located in Orem.

The acquisition will be accounted for as a purchase of assets. Impact Media is a marketing product development company specializing in electronic multimedia brochures, custom-designed CDs, and other Internet products that Galaxy plans to cross-market to its customer base and prospects from other channels. Impact posted more than $3 million in sales in 1998.

Terms of the letter of intent provide for Galaxy's purchase of substantially all the assets and assumption of certain liabilities of Impact Media. Exact terms of the purchase were not disclosed.

Closing of the acquisition is subject to the completion of a due diligence review, and the preparation and approval of a final agreement by the company's board of directors. Galaxy expects to consummate the transaction on or about March 15, 1999.

Impact Media (Impact Media (http://www.impact-media.net) first began selling its products in January 1998, and after its first year of operation reported revenues in excess of $3 million, while operating profitably.

Management anticipates its sales to exceed $7 million in 1999, which does not include additional revenue expected from the cross-marketing of each company's products to the other. Product integration and cross selling is only part of the post-acquisition plan.

In addition to its own electronic brochure and CD marketing products, Impact markets two of Galaxy's products under private labels.

Impact is a reseller for Galaxy's Banner Source (http://www.bannersource.com), which provides banner advertising to the Internet community, and also markets Galaxy Center, under the name Impact Avenue (http://www.impactavenue.com), which is a software program that allows Internet users to create their own commercial Web sites and then publish the sites to the Internet.

About Impact Media

Impact Media, a developer of two cutting-edge electronic marketing products for small and large businesses alike, is located south of Salt Lake City. Impact's products include electronic multimedia brochures, and custom-designed CDs, similar to the Shape CD(TM).

About Galaxy Enterprises

Galaxy Enterprises is an e-solutions provider, trainer and facilitator of Internet-based businesses, an operator of an electronic mall, an e-commerce Web site builder and a broad-based Web search engine. Galaxy Mall Inc. (http://www.galaxymall.com), a wholly owned subsidiary, is one of the fastest growing malls on the Internet with approximately 1,700 storefronts and 10 million hits monthly.

Galaxy Center (http://www.galaxycenter.com), a Web-based, Web site builder program, allows individuals and business owners to create and maintain their own fully functional e-commerce Web sites. MatchSite (http://www.matchsite.com) is Galaxy's new revolutionary broad-based search engine that queries other major search engines simultaneously, which eliminates the need for multiple queries.

Banner Source (http://www.bannersource.com), is a clearing house for Web banner advertisements, which currently has access to a network of more than 20,000 sites and markets in excess of 1 million dynamic impressions over the Internet daily.
